Dexcom Follow app for friends & family

The Dexcom CGM System comes with a built-in Dexcom Share feature so you can let up to 10 people follow your glucose levels, giving you a circle of support. By downloading the Dexcom Follow app, Followers can view your glucose data directly from their smart device, whether they live down the street or in another country.*

Sharing glucose data with followers is associated with:

time in range icon

MORE TIME-IN-RANGE1

Data shows that a greater number of Followers correlates with more time spent in range and less time <70 mg/dL.*
a1c icon

PATIENT-REPORTED A1C IMPROVEMENTS2

People with Followers report that data sharing has played a role in lowering their A1C.*
Fewer episodes of hypoglycemia icon

FEWER EPISODES OF HYPOGLYCEMIA2

People with Followers reported experiencing fewer episodes of hypoglycemia and feeling more confident in their ability to avoid and manage low glucose events.*
improved sleep icon

IMPROVED AMOUNT OF QUALITY SLEEP2

A study of adults with diabetes showed that data sharing results in more quality sleep for the person with diabetes.
well-being icon

GREATER WELL-BEING2

Dexcom users report data sharing gives them greater peace of mind and helps them feel less alone with their diabetes.
reduced distress icon

REDUCED DIABETES DISTRESS2

1 out of 3 surveyed adults with T1D who shared their Dexcom glucose data with a Follower reported a reduction in diabetes distress.*

Customizable data sharing and notifications so you are always in control

We’ve designed the Share/Follow feature so that Dexcom CGM users can pick and choose what they want to share and with which Followers.*
Followers* can modify notifications and check on their Sharer’s status at anytime as long as they have been allowed access.
